4,294,999,632 is a composite number, even.
4,294,999,632 (four billion two hundred ninety-four million nine hundred ninety-nine thousand six hundred thirty-two) is an even 10-digit number. It is a composite number with 80 divisors, and factors as 2⁴ × 3 × 7 × 11 × 1,162,067. Its proper divisors sum to 9,538,257,840, more than the number itself, making it an abundant number.
